300PLC配置上传后无法监视的故障排查与解决方案附详细操作指南

at 2025.11.02 08:46  ca 设备销售区  pv 1519  by 工控设备哥  

300PLC配置上传后无法监视的故障排查与解决方案(附详细操作指南)

一、300PLC监视功能失效的典型问题表现

1.1 通信链路中断特征

当300PLC完成配置文件上传后,监控画面出现以下异常:

- 系统拓扑图中设备状态持续显示"离线"

- HMI界面无任何设备实时数据刷新

- 通信状态指示灯保持红色常亮

- 诊断日志中频繁出现"Modbus TCP连接超时"错误

1.2 数据采集异常现象

典型故障场景包括:

- I/O模块数据采集出现数据漂移(如数字量输入在0/1间随机跳动)

- 模拟量输入出现固定值显示(如温度传感器数据锁定在25℃)

- 计算寄存器数据持续清零

- 系统时间与PLC内部时钟偏差超过±5分钟

二、300PLC通信架构深度

2.1 网络拓扑结构

典型工业网络架构包含:

- 物理层:双冗余以太网交换机(支持工业级环网)

- 数据链路层:Modbus TCP协议(波特率9600-115200)

- 传输层:IPV4地址分配(建议使用静态地址)

- 应用层:Profinet/Profibus-DP协议(需配置正确网关)

2.2 设备配置参数清单

关键配置参数包括:

| 参数类型 | 必要配置项 | 推荐值 |

|----------|------------|--------|

| 网络参数 | IP地址/子网掩码 | 192.168.1.X/24 |

| | 网关地址 | 192.168.1.1 |

| | 端口映射 | 502(TCP) |

| 设备参数 | CPU型号 | S7-300-2 PN/DP |

| | 工作模式 | 程序运行 |

| | 系统时间 | NTP服务器同步 |

三、系统级故障排查流程

3.1 通信链路诊断四步法

1) 物理层检测:使用网线直连PLC与上位机,观察指示灯状态

- 正常:绿色状态指示灯持续闪烁

- 异常:红色常亮(可能存在硬件故障)

2) 协议层测试:通过TIA Portal进行Modbus诊断

- 操作路径:设备树→诊断→Modbus TCP测试

- 测试方法:发送/接收保持寄存器数据

3) 数据链路分析:抓包工具捕获网络流量

- 建议工具:Wireshark(过滤modbus-tcp)

- 正常流量特征:每5秒周期性发送数据包

4) 网络环境验证:使用ping命令测试连通性

- 有效响应:<20ms延迟,丢包率<0.1%

- 异常情况:超时或高丢包率(需检查路由表)

3.2 典型故障案例

案例1:配置冲突导致通信中断

- 现象:上传V2.0配置后监视失效

- 原因:CPU固件版本为V2.01,配置文件要求V2.0+

- 解决方案:升级至V2.02固件包

图片 300PLC配置上传后无法监视的故障排查与解决方案(附详细操作指南)2

案例2:地址映射错误引发数据丢失

图片 300PLC配置上传后无法监视的故障排查与解决方案(附详细操作指南)

- 现象:DO模块数据无法采集

- 原因:配置文件中Q0.0与实际模块地址不一致

- 诊断方法:使用S7-300诊断工具查看实际地址

案例3:冗余链路配置异常

- 现象:主备网络切换频繁

- 原因:冗余组网络延迟差>50ms

- 解决方案:调整交换机VLAN优先级

4.1 配置上传最佳实践

1) 文件版本管理:建立配置版本控制表

| 版本 | 上传时间 | 适用系统 | 验证状态 |

|------|----------|----------|----------|

| V1.5 | -08-01 | SP1 | 已验证 |

2) 上传前验证流程:

- 使用校验工具计算CRC32值

- 检查配置文件签名(数字证书验证)

- 模拟器预测试(推荐使用S7-300 EMU)

4.2 系统健康监测方案

1) 实时监控指标:

- CPU负载率:<30%

- 内存占用率:<75%

- 网络延迟:<50ms

- 通信丢包率:<0.5%

2) 自动报警配置:

- 严重故障(红色):CPU过热>85℃

- 轻微故障(黄色):网络延迟>100ms

- 预警阈值:数据刷新间隔>3秒

五、进阶配置与性能调优

5.1 高速数据采集配置

1) 突发模式设置:

- 诊断周期:100ms(推荐值)

- 数据缓冲区:2048字节

- 采样精度:12位(模拟量)

|-------------|--------|--------|

| TCP超时时间 | 5秒 | 2秒 |

| 持久连接 | 关闭 | 开启 |

| 缓冲区大小 | 4096 | 8192 |

5.2 冗余系统配置指南

1) 双网冗余方案:

- 主网络:IP 192.168.1.10/24

- 备网络:IP 192.168.1.11/24

- 网关:192.168.1.1(双网共享)

- 预警阈值:主网延迟>50ms

- 切换耗时:<1.5秒

- 故障恢复:<3秒

六、常见问题快速解决手册

6.1 故障代码索引

| 错误代码 | 描述 | 解决方案 |

|----------|------------------------|------------------------------|

| E0001 | 通信超时 | 检查网线连通性 |

| E0007 | 配置校验失败 | 重新下载最新配置文件 |

| E0012 | 网络接口异常 | 重启交换机并更新驱动 |

| E0025 | 寄存器映射冲突 | 调整配置文件地址范围 |

6.2 快速诊断工具包

1) 必备软件清单:

- TIA Portal V16(推荐)

- WinCC V7.5+

图片 300PLC配置上传后无法监视的故障排查与解决方案(附详细操作指南)1

- PLC-MONitor(第三方工具)

- Wireshark(网络分析)

2) 诊断流程图:

配置上传 → 检查物理连接 → 测试Modbus通信 → 验证配置参数 → 调试数据采集 → 系统测试

七、典型应用场景实施案例

7.1 智能仓储系统改造

项目背景:某汽车零部件仓库需要实现2000+托盘的实时监控

实施步骤:

1) 网络规划:采用工业环网+AP冗余架构

3) 性能指标:达成200ms级响应速度

4) 运行效果:故障率降低至0.03次/千小时

7.2 钢铁厂高炉控制系统

技术难点:高温环境下设备稳定性

解决方案:

1) 采用光纤通信模块(工业级IP67)

2) 配置温度补偿算法(采样间隔1s)

3) 双电源冗余设计(断电自动切换)

4) 实施效果:连续运行时间突破8000小时

八、未来技术演进方向

8.1 工业物联网集成

1) 5G专网接入方案

2) 边缘计算节点部署

3) 数字孪生系统对接

8.2 智能诊断技术

1) 机器学习预测性维护

2) 自动化根因分析(RCA)

3) AR远程支持系统

8.3 网络安全增强

1) VPN隧道加密传输

2) 数字证书认证

九、专业服务支持体系

9.1 技术支持热线

- 7×24小时服务:400-800-3000

- 优先级响应:黄金(30分钟)→铂金(2小时)→白银(4小时)

9.2 实验室验证服务

1) 模拟现场测试(S7-300 TestBox)

2) 网络压力测试(模拟500+设备接入)

3) 故障复现分析(提供详细报告)

9.3 培训服务体系

1) 基础操作认证(3天课程)

3) 项目实战训练营(7天)

十、维护管理最佳实践

10.1 文档管理体系

1) 配置文件版本控制

2) 设备健康档案

3) 故障处理记录

10.2 预防性维护计划

| 维护周期 | 内容 | 预期效果 |

|----------|--------------------------|--------------------|

| 日常 | 检查网络连接 | 故障率降低40% |

| 月度 | 系统备份与固件升级 | 系统可用性提升25% |

| 季度 | 通信模块检测 | 故障响应时间缩短30%|

10.3 成本控制策略

1) 故障预测模型:MTBF提升至20000小时

3) 能耗监控:实施电力分析系统

本文共计3268字,详细阐述了300PLC系统在监视功能失效时的系统化解决方案,涵盖从基础排查到高级调优的全流程技术方案。通过结构化的问题分析、标准化的排查流程和前瞻性的技术规划,为工业自动化工程师提供完整的实践指南。建议收藏本文作为技术手册,定期查阅更新,确保系统持续稳定运行。

相关阅读